While driving my explorer when I start to change
gears engaging the clutch the engine wants to just
race away until I let out on the clutch then it idles
back down but it's very inconsistent it just like it
does it when ever it wants to ?

1 Answer

26,325

Are you certain you are not pressing the accellerator with the other foot? My daughter did this and it drove me crazy until I figured out she was concentrating too much on her clutch work and let her right foot gently push on the gas when she was clutching.
